What You’ll Be Doing
Lead the design, development, and industrialisation of machine-learning solutions using Azure Databricks.
Collaborate closely with healthcare experts, data engineers, business analysts, and policy stakeholders to identify high-value use cases and translate business needs into actionable, data-driven solutions.
Develop and deploy anomaly-detection, risk-scoring, and classification models using both supervised and unsupervised techniques.
Define and implement model evaluation strategies, ensuring accuracy, explainability, and operational value.
Work hands-on with Databricks and Azure services, including PySpark, Delta Lake, Unity Catalog, MLflow, Workflows, Azure Data Factory, Azure DevOps, and Azure Storage.
Apply best practices in security, privacy, governance, and responsible AI throughout the solution lifecycle.
Provide technical leadership, set standards, and mentor team members to elevate the team’s capabilities.
Drive collaboration on data/ML pipelines, feature engineering, and seamless solution integration.
What We’re Looking For
Master’s or Ph.D. in Data Science, Computer Science, AI, Statistics, Mathematics, Engineering, or equivalent experience.
Minimum 10 years of experience in data science, machine learning, or advanced analytics.
Proven expertise in Python, SQL, Azure Databricks, and PySpark.
Deep knowledge of machine learning techniques, including anomaly detection, classification, and clustering.
Hands-on experience with MLflow, Delta Lake, Unity Catalog, and Databricks Workflows.
Familiarity with Git, automated testing, CI/CD, and MLOps practices.
Experience with explainable AI, risk scoring, and large-scale data processing.
Background in healthcare, insurance, fraud detection, or the public sector is a strong asset.
Experience working in agile environments and collaborating within multidisciplinary teams.
Strong analytical, technical, and problem-solving skills with a pragmatic, delivery-focused mindset.
Ability to translate complex business needs into scalable analytical solutions.
Clear communicator with leadership capabilities and a strong focus on explainability, quality, and maintainability.
Team player, flexible, and eager to learn.
